Kennedy Students Flip Pancakes to Help Local Boy

The Short Stacks for a Tall Cause fundraiser will aid Jake Lonigro in his fight against cancer.

The junior class at John F. Kennedy High School in the Bellmore-Merrick Central High School District hosted a pancake breakfast fundraiser to help a younger member of the community.

Short Stacks for a Tall Cause was held on Oct. 16 to benefit the family of a 12-year-old Merrick boy fighting a rare form of cancer.

Nearly $1,500 was raised for Jake Lonigro and his family. Jake has an older sibling that attends Kennedy.

“The whole event and planning for it has been the most rewarding outside of the classroom experience for me,” said social studies teacher Kristy Faulkner.
